What Does Perpetual Offer and What Do Customers Expect?

Perpetual Company offers investment management, wealth management, and corporate trust services, so buyers are not just paying for products. They expect disciplined process, careful advice, and precise execution from a firm built on trust.

Icon

Core brand promise: trust, precision, and client focus

In the Brand Audience of Perpetual Company view, the promise is bigger than access to funds or trust work. Clients expect the Perpetual Company business model to turn specialist knowledge into clear guidance, timely action, and steady oversight.

  • Investment management, wealth advice, and corporate trust
  • Institutions expect process discipline and consistency
  • Individuals expect clarity, discretion, and responsiveness
  • Accuracy and timeliness protect revenue and reputation

What does Perpetual Company do in practice? It serves different client groups with different needs, but the common thread is service quality. Institutional clients want institutional-grade portfolio management. High-net-worth clients want tailored advice and privacy. Retail investors want clear terms, easy access, and fair treatment. Corporate trust clients expect precise administration in debt trustee, securitisation, and managed fund work, where missed steps can damage outcomes fast.

How Does Perpetual Make Money Without Diluting Trust?

Perpetual Company makes money in ways that can still feel fair when fees are clear, tied to service, and easy to compare. The Perpetual Company business model works best when management fees, advice fees, and trustee or administration fees match visible value, so the Perpetual Company brand promise stays aligned with client outcomes.

Revenue Element How It Affects Trust Why It Matters
Management fees Trust stays stronger when the fee is disclosed, measured, and linked to portfolio work. Clients can judge if the fee matches the service they get in Perpetual Company services.
Advice fees These support trust only when advice is independent, clear, and not pushed to sell extra products. Advice fees shape how Perpetual Company customer experience feels during high-stakes decisions.
Trustee or administration service fees These feel fair when the work is routine, visible, and priced for the service level. This supports Perpetual Company operations because clients can see what is being done and why it costs money.

The most trust-sensitive choice is advice fees, because they can blur into product selling if the incentive is not clean.
